Exploring Prescott National Forest

One of the top attractions in the area is Prescott National Forest. While some areas of the forest may still be closed due to the fire, there are still many beautiful trails to explore. One personal favorite is the Thumb Butte Trail, which offers stunning views of the surrounding mountains and valleys.

Visiting the Granite Mountain Hotshots Memorial State Park

The Granite Mountain Hotshots Memorial State Park is a powerful tribute to the 19 firefighters who lost their lives in the Yarnell Hill Fire of 2013. The park features a hiking trail that leads to a memorial site, where visitors can pay their respects and learn more about the brave men who fought the fire.

Understanding the Impact of the Goodwin Fire

The Goodwin Fire of 2017 had a significant impact on the local community and environment. The fire burned over 28,000 acres of land and destroyed 33 homes. However, the community has come together to rebuild and support one another in the aftermath.

Protecting the Local Wildlife

The fire also had a major impact on the local wildlife, with many animals losing their homes and habitats. Organizations like the Arizona Game and Fish Department have worked to protect and rehabilitate affected wildlife, ensuring that the ecosystem can recover and thrive.
